/**********************************************/
/*  	© DSL - Factory 2008            	  */
/* 		Talstraße 6							  */
/* 		08066 Zwickau						  */
/**********************************************/

/**********************************************/
/* allgemeine HTML Tag Styles				  */
/**********************************************/ 
h1 {
	font-family:Tahoma;
	font-size:12px;
	font-weight:bold;
	color:#919191;
	text-transform:uppercase;
	letter-spacing:1px;
	margin-top:4px;
	margin-bottom:4px;}

h2 {
	font-weight:bold;
	font-size:11px;
	color:#FFFFFF;
	background-color:#27b9b7;
	display:inline;}
	
h3 {
	font-weight:bold;
	font-size:11px;
	color:#FFFFFF;
	background-color:#94be0e;
	display:inline;}

select{
	font-size:11px;
}
/************************************************/
/* Listen-Styles                                */
/************************************************/
	
.strichliste{
	padding-left: 0;
	margin-left: 0;}

.strichliste li{
	margin: 0;
	padding-top: 10px;
	padding-bottom: 10px;
	background-image:url(../img_web/bg/strichlinie_hor.gif);
	background-repeat:repeat-x;
	list-style-type: none;}

.pktliste{
	display:block;
	margin:0px;
	padding:0px;
	padding-top:10px;
	padding-bottom:10px;}

.pktliste li {
	background-image: url(../img_web/allg/li_pkt.gif);
	background-repeat:no-repeat;
	background-position:5px;
	list-style:none;
	margin:0px;
	padding-left:20px;
	padding-top:5px;
	padding-bottom:5px;}	


/************************************************/
/* allgemeine Link Styles                       */
/************************************************/

a,a:visited{
	color:#9ec424;
	text-decoration: none;
	font-weight:bold;
	border-bottom:dashed 1px #27b9b7;
	
}
a:hover{
	color:#27b9b7;
	text-decoration: none;
}

a.ohne:hover,a.ohne,a.ohne:visited  {
	border:none;
}

/* News schriftdefinition homeseite */
a.newskurz_titel,a.newskurz_titel:visited{
	font-weight:bold;
	font-size:11px;
	color:#FFFFFF;
	background-color:#94be0e;
}
a.newskurz_titel:hover{
	background-color:#27b9b7;
	color:#FFFFFF;
	
}
a.newskurz_text,a.newskurz_text:visited{
	color:#2d382b;
	border-bottom:0px;
	font-weight:normal;
}
a.newskurz_text:hover,a.newskurz_text:active{
	color:#2d382b;
	background-color:#d4f1f1;
}

/* Eventtitel */
a.event_titel,a.event_titel:visited{
	font-weight:bold;
	font-size:11px;
	color:#FFFFFF;
	background-color:#27b9b7;
}
a.event_titel:hover{
	background-color:#94be0e;
	color:#FFFFFF;
	
}

a.event_text,a.event_text:visited{
	color:#2d382b;
	border-bottom:0px;
	font-weight:normal;
}
a.event_text:hover{
	background-color:#f4ffcf;
	color:#2d382b;
}

/************************************************/
/* Klassen                                      */
/************************************************/

.hr{
	background-image:url(../img_web/bg/strichlinie_hor.gif);
	background-repeat:repeat-x;
	background-position:0px 5px;
	height:15px;
}
.tdgruen{
	color:#2d382b;}
.tgruen{
	color:#94be0e;}
.tblau{
	color:#27b9b7; font-weight:bold;
}
.t10grau{
	font-size:10px;
	color:#b6b6b6;
}

.box_newsbild{
	background-image:url(../img_web/bg/news_rahmen.gif);
	float:left;
	width:106px;
	height:70px;
	margin-right:10px;
	padding-top:9px;
	padding-left:5px;
	padding-right:5px;
	padding-bottom:10px;
	text-align:center;
}
.box_grossbild{
	background-image:url(../img_web/bg/bilder_hg_news.jpg);
	width:255px;
	height:170px;
	margin:0px auto;
	padding-top:9px;
	padding-left:6px;
	padding-right:7px;
	padding-bottom:10px;
	text-align:center;
}
.box_artistsbild{
	background-image:url(../img_web/bg/hg_bilder_artists.gif);
	background-repeat:no-repeat;
	float:left;
	width:127px;
	height:136px;
	text-align:center;
	margin-right:6px;
	margin-top:6px;
	padding-right:5px;
	padding-left:5px;
	padding-top:8px;
}
.box_artistsbild_detail{

	FILTER: progid:DXImageTransform.Microsoft.AlphaImageLoader(src=http://dslserver3/le_agency/img_web/bg/hg_bilder_artists.png,sizingMethod=crop);	
	background-repeat:no-repeat;
	float:left;
	width:127px;
	height:136px;
	text-align:center;
	margin-right:10px;
	padding-right:5px;
	padding-left:5px;
	padding-top:8px;
}
.box_artistsbild_detail[class]{
	background: transparent url(http://dslserver3/le_agency/img_web/bg/hg_bilder_artists.png) no-repeat scroll 0%;
	-moz-background-clip: initial; 
	-moz-background-origin: initial; 
	-moz-background-inline-policy: initial;
}


.box_roster{
	background-image:url(../img_web/bg/roster.jpg);
	background-repeat:no-repeat;
	padding-top:18px;
	height:64px;
	padding-left:45px;
}

.box_kalender{
	background-image:url(../img_web/bg/kalender.jpg);
	background-repeat:no-repeat;
	height:205px;
	padding-top:18px;
	padding-left:45px;
}

.booking input{
	width:250px;
	background-image:url(../img_web/bg/streifenmuster.gif);
	border-right:1px solid #f2f2f3;
	border-bottom:1px solid #f2f2f3;
	border-top: none;
	border-left:none;
	font-weight: bold;
	margin:3px;
	padding:2px;
	font-size:12px;
}

.kontakt input{
	width:170px;
	background-image:url(../img_web/bg/streifenmuster.gif);
	border-right:1px solid #f2f2f3;
	border-bottom:1px solid #f2f2f3;
	border-top: none;
	border-left:none;
	font-weight: bold;
	margin:3px;
	padding:2px;
	font-size:12px;
}
.kontakt textarea{
	background-image:url(../img_web/bg/streifenmuster.gif);
	border-right:1px solid #f2f2f3;
	border-bottom:1px solid #f2f2f3;
	border-top: none;
	border-left:none;
	font-size:11px;
	font-weight: bold;
	font-family:Verdana, Arial, Helvetica, sans-serif,
}

